House Gospel Choir is a London-based vocal group founded by Natalie Maddix in 2014 to perform at Glastonbury Festival. The choir consists of five members: Natalie Maddix, Zehra Lewis-Wright, Siziwe Sayiya, Cartell Green-Brown, and Liza Jennings, who blend house music with gospel vocals.

The group produces house and afro house tracks, with releases on Armada Music and fabric Records since 2024. Their sound incorporates melodic house and techno elements alongside drum and bass and electro influences, delivering gospel-infused vocals over contemporary electronic productions. House Gospel Choir has released five tracks between November 2024 and December 2025, establishing their presence in the underground house scene through their distinctive vocal-driven approach to electronic music.
